Legal Definition -
Bribery - The corrupt payment, receipt, or solicitation of a private
favor for an official action.
Bribe - A price, reward, gift, or favor bestowed or promised with a
view to pervert the judgment of or influence the action of a person in a
position of trust.
Black's
Law Dictionary® Eighth Edition © 2004
Current
Usage -
Heinrich von Pierer, the former chief executive of Siemens, the German
engineering group under investigation for
bribery, has told a German
newspaper that allegations he arranged
bribes are untrue.
"These accusations are not true," von Pierer told the Welt am Sonntag in a
story published on Sunday.
The Sueddeutsche Zeitung newspaper reported on Saturday that a former
Siemens manager had accused Von Pierer of asking him and others to arrange
bribes.
Reuters,
April 19, 2008
